Pints to Pasta

Once again it's time to sign up for the Pints to Pasta run and it's for a couple good causes.

This is one race worth running because it's giving a portion of its proceeds to The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society's Team in Training AND The Boys and Girls Clubs and there are more than a couple great sponsors to help kick this off.

The Old Spaghetti Factory and Widmer Brothers Brewing are a couple of the tastiest sponsors - thus the meaning behind the name: Pints to Pasta.

It's a fun 10k run that starts at Adidas (another sponsor) and the run begins on a downhill slope :) then it's off to the waterfront and finally the runners are making feet to the festive food at the Spaghetti Factory.

Plus for those who don't want to chug a beer at 10 in the morning, there's always a cold glass of Jamba Juice waiting at the finish line.

The run is on September 11th so you still have time to sign up. I hope to see you there and I've got my fingers crossed that the weather will hold out and we'll have a little more sunshine for our run.

Pints to Pasta - Fundraiser RUN


It was an early run, which might be a good thing because it wasn't hot-yet. I had to get up at 6:00 a.m. to meet up with my sister and Melissa to head to the starting point.

It was Sunday, September 13, 2009 and this was the second time I've done the run to help raise money for a couple good causes. It's the Pints to Pasta. The bad thing was I wasn't prepared. I hadn't run for a loooooooooooong time. Luckily I made it to the finish. Of course it was only a 10K run or 6.2 miles. But. . . there's always next year.

I am going to be so much more prepared for this run, next time. No. REALLY.

The run helps raise money for The Raphael House of Portland and The Leukemia and Lymphoma Society's TEAM IN TRAINING. A huge thanks is owed to the sponsors: Adidas, Widmer, The Old Spaghetti Factory, Jamba Juice and Portland Running Company for making this event happen.
